#11 DI Hockey shuts out #13 Calvin to advance to programs first GLCHL Championship

2/16/2024 10:28:00 PM

The #11 Purdue Northwest ACHA DI Hockey advanced to the programs first-ever GLCHL Championship game after shutting out #13 Calvin in the Semi-Finals on Friday night, 4-0.

The Basics
  • Records: #11 Purdue Northwest (28-6,13-4), #13 Calvin (21-8)
  • Location: Farmington Hills Ice Arena - Farmington Hills, Mich.
  • Attendance: 100
Inside The Numbers
  • Sophomore Michael Clough (Andover, Minn./)  led the Pride with two goals and an assist.
  • Junior Sam Bourdages (Hearst, Ontario/) and sophomore Andrew Remer (Lake Orion, Mich./) each netted one goal and one assist.
  • Sophomore Carter Hobbs (Des Moines, Iowa/) chipped in two assists during the game.
  • Sophomore Cooper Olson (Maple Grove, Minn./) played all 60 minutes between the pipes for the Pride and recorded 43 saves to earn his sixth shutout on the season and second straight of the tournament.
  • Adam Yost played all 60 minutes in the net for the Knights making 34 total saves.
The Breakdown
  • The Pride scored two goals early in the first period to take a 2-0 lead into the second.
  • The Pride netted two more goals in the second period to increase their lead to 4-0.
  • Both teams were held scoreless in the third period after outstanding goal-tending and penalty killing to secure the 4-0 win for Purdue Northwest.
Up Next
  • The Pride now compete tomorrow in the GLCHL Championship game Farmington Hills, Mich. against top-seeded and #2 Adrian on Saturday, February 17. Puck-drop is set 4:30 PM CT at the Farmington Hills Ice Arena.
